Applications are invited for appointment as Senior Lecturer (2 posts) in the School of Biomedical Sciences (Ref.: 498848), to commence as soon as possible, on a two- or three-year fixed-term basis, with the possibility of renewal. 

Applicants should have a Ph.D., M.D. or M.B.B.S. degree and be highly motivated in teaching and learning. They should have at least 10 years of demonstrated experience and excellence in the teaching of gross anatomy and histology for medical, nursing, pharmacy, and biomedical sciences undergraduate programmes. They should also have the ability to lead innovation in the development of both cadaveric and AR/VR approaches for the teaching of anatomy.  The appointees will strengthen the teaching of anatomy, and help to lead a team of colleagues dedicated to the development, delivery and scholarship of innovative pedagogical approaches.  For further information about the post, please contact Dr. Julian Tanner at jatanner@hku.hk

A highly competitive salary commensurate with qualifications and experience will be offered, in addition to annual leave and medical benefits.  At current rates, salaries tax does not exceed 15% of gross income.  The appointments will attract a contract-end gratuity and University contribution to a retirement benefits scheme, totalling up to 15% of basic salary.  Housing benefits will also be provided as applicable.
